From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from EUR01-VE1-obe.outbound.protection.outlook.com (mail-ve1eur01on0052.outbound.protection.outlook.com [104.47.1.52]) by dpdk.org (Postfix) with ESMTP id C5742A51 for ; Tue, 24 Apr 2018 11:17:53 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=Mellanox.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version; bh=FO3Yc/X+2T5oMWuzC4Qu85rAjzrIwCCu0Mten0aVXZk=; b=ryJwbKZaCXkWiQ2VyKL5MFW661W2NA/CG4XnLgLpZR/ogwlpIU0Gnl81s2Z6oeX4EbztEzAA83n2EuHSY67vwci0XCxuXBu3nwFRTPZcxKm2pvf5OYdYWv2ppFcfP9qH8Ag28Hc/zW8QC75NaO5hFYOjZy2w5Fm595tfFuFIJBo=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=yskoh@mellanox.com; Received: from yongseok-MBP.local (73.222.116.174) by AM5PR0501MB2033.eurprd05.prod.outlook.com (2603:10a6:203:1a::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.696.13; Tue, 24 Apr 2018 09:17:50 +0000 Date: Tue, 24 Apr 2018 02:17:36 -0700 From: Yongseok Koh To: Xueming Li Cc: Shahaf Shuler , dev@dpdk.org Message-ID: <20180424091735.GA84177@yongseok-MBP.local> References: <20180408124121.110975-1-xuemingl@mellanox.com> <20180408124121.110975-2-xuemingl@mellanox.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20180408124121.110975-2-xuemingl@mellanox.com> User-Agent: Mutt/1.9.3 (2018-01-21) X-Originating-IP: [73.222.116.174] X-ClientProxiedBy: CO2PR04CA0091.namprd04.prod.outlook.com (2603:10b6:104:6::17) To AM5PR0501MB2033.eurprd05.prod.outlook.com (2603:10a6:203:1a::19) X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-HT: Tenant X-Microsoft-Antispam: UriScan:; BCL:0; PCL:0; RULEID:(7020095)(4652020)(48565401081)(5600026)(2017052603328)(7153060)(7193020); SRVR:AM5PR0501MB2033; X-Microsoft-Exchange-Diagnostics: 1; AM5PR0501MB2033; 3:o5P0X9ilO1/OQ9ArNb+tGLj6Og0/JNUGF14ge93KNp7KDWE720jLZu5k6f5nkjgquPFj+8cUPgskD8AcvHY3gnyG92WrHVCRkNFiMyqcHSTx+zap5OtIDpLNT33UlX3acaq+iRRbVm2P71u5Poj+QGOqO5SnD4uTa8QpWGypQhr08z87NkLmIYlXSQyGSe4RrnK5BJGXQdk5y9rQFISbix4J+70o8J3bddteDhLxOyANy0m1Wfo95XscUe86iRQ5; 25:m4g2/y9RlxvxJHzd8GmBQh6VNg/OQHLrJLf2KcLCiVS8LZiWd2pyopJEMjU3xMueQnEkHVKn4QBhRq7ZIHUBM3N8wXcQaUfndmjbIu9jMngDA3pqKdzvfVnF9SpIcXjC/fSaZ62PmT5saHcioiSCPXtm9J8BhIn9tySOyz2aEDPqhDKbAEDvY2pPIG9D9bDsmXeq8arCE8jIJFb2EsLwwILRBr1/ddKY5DCum1EhxREJ8BVkZWVnGH4Fr7UJCGOR21W/sD7lpr8jRs0wRal/ysguOalbyNiPjUWJH5XPCBeZ1e/3wRoy9SpNNpBYBsbklNr7LkSaOh9c29qmCnc+iw==; 31:eHZyuRT7VyKYZzLebVRzwcl/6P5pqOqSLdQMt/FeFP2SzS9zniVoy1qKSEkp4cF8+QHhyY47cWc80/1fxgBVtwAHvdqSbBOXckAGEnhr6Fif3L/VAIvGuz1IVnOcz9df8FZ0HrmiWr5J12mDZFBi3z6PVSk8M16vY/TZ4+jBNA3YncsVVhGuYJ1jazk6+vhrccrDogcihVFjqBAeQBq/+PmlTsUPRbIAwu9QGk8kNoE= X-MS-TrafficTypeDiagnostic: AM5PR0501MB2033: X-Microsoft-Exchange-Diagnostics: 1; AM5PR0501MB2033; 20:jEpgeT0RXr1uteyMALwS143E2DczJPcbAtlVf5QRguLsKi53WQHe3yvnvWchUuLss2Me7vix7bBg0CYN939uXep0cgCwEsOiDQIhwWchPQXipClHQbs0pGpucMnZSbJUzyPbuZ7UHjoeP3BHC0gVoSPdP+WAnyLsvQBxzTznJbEnYlQtdHFvrpLQxZ7sWxc/VNGk3gOh/YBnGI9HgMSoV3MW1233OAltXiweIX4GLBXYxV1VnyrG5LSBXZ2aFsgplUvVgp9e5Tso44S8fq7OltDCPNHZNi1JEqefpCVP0eLnxUPQvfxPmKdkyCPL+dxP1dEw2sLq223vuTfzpDcco3NiqYHy/UvZUXtH/XtR4EAUm6KiDz5UKnQ+IQYuurmrdTSu5rpM7WQYq5aqJogAblkLq2lyP6tPzwugqfprpKPejuVn1IrfnGgsjFisnLfx1YAp7j8DdIpeA1oYUD9/LVhBOHGOIrt8exqvR20rGr/C6QK1ympq//7HMCJ8+TrU; 4:8XxDiRi3ghRAjK2kn29CPLXCrO8MDa9o6bQgEXiCHnoTnwQcULU7wdg3utY9AIaXvElGva6LMbeowhrGf06KAZjn+wh9WckhF6tNqZdKlcwBU/1t481E+FbuT2640C6GrVz5sAfSZvarHGOWffSP252iGn3eruJjwEVv6VJBm9rWKzlmgmBU+9Q0iPXLxmokTgOWLddqu6dpyzM67TkMIHYIU7ee3JP8jziaAjLOLv1D4PV8Aa1tu3FAy8KwwjUQPTaHGsN+MpndZwREQ4tkbA== X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:; X-Exchange-Antispam-Report-CFA-Test: BCL:0; PCL:0; RULEID:(8211001083)(6040522)(2401047)(5005006)(8121501046)(3231232)(944501410)(52105095)(10201501046)(93006095)(93001095)(3002001)(6055026)(6041310)(20161123560045)(20161123558120)(20161123562045)(201703131423095)(201702281528075)(20161123555045)(201703061421075)(201703061406153)(20161123564045)(6072148)(201708071742011); SRVR:AM5PR0501MB2033; BCL:0; PCL:0; RULEID:; SRVR:AM5PR0501MB2033; X-Forefront-PRVS: 0652EA5565 X-Forefront-Antispam-Report: SFV:NSPM; SFS:(10009020)(376002)(396003)(346002)(366004)(39380400002)(39860400002)(189003)(199004)(26005)(55016002)(1076002)(8676002)(6116002)(3846002)(23726003)(53936002)(11346002)(97736004)(6506007)(558084003)(9686003)(956004)(446003)(305945005)(476003)(2906002)(7736002)(386003)(58126008)(66066001)(47776003)(33896004)(316002)(76176011)(16586007)(7696005)(486006)(52116002)(6862004)(50466002)(106356001)(4326008)(6636002)(16526019)(105586002)(8936002)(5660300001)(25786009)(86362001)(81166006)(229853002)(81156014)(68736007)(6666003)(98436002)(478600001)(33656002)(6246003)(18370500001); DIR:OUT; SFP:1101; SCL:1; SRVR:AM5PR0501MB2033; H:yongseok-MBP.local; FPR:; SPF:None; LANG:en; PTR:InfoNoRecords; MX:1; A:1; Received-SPF: None (protection.outlook.com: mellanox.com does not designate permitted sender hosts) X-Microsoft-Exchange-Diagnostics: =?us-ascii?Q?1; AM5PR0501MB2033; 23:ekWcy4r71i+CKrYq8s9AMaBzVi6n8ancsbcOmEw?= =?us-ascii?Q?yIhRaJ4fTWeoWDjOIvfUgzGyDsPPyaL7YxfIgQ1GL0DnVCP3xjb3YjTfWsUH?= =?us-ascii?Q?iog8KTcGffumGDHa7MpXQ8Ohmtt709kalfDwEcaiy/f5nieAwkx5HqcN63et?= =?us-ascii?Q?vzY1tiyhJeYJH6iRq4DXmRbJL/XNxDr8s7Dh6855INOqsxqhQDAbVIS+8gFZ?= =?us-ascii?Q?Db12xB9Ymra4kkv365+YZb/elYwtZgN0XJrCDnQIlJ12Q0F1oS7BRojX3kDe?= =?us-ascii?Q?B/x8Uw+kHfnGntkqWCNE0qMfT1gusaa42QR/ROj0IG6YpZ750xdJ5ohuwWVd?= =?us-ascii?Q?oxNqxgeiQ+7pZPi9GwG0eh7HQduR/lBgsyXFsSWk9ddtS0DD6b2vPLqGXJB0?= =?us-ascii?Q?TvKd5DSWtnkzJ8R1f5IvtJpKTv4mmtm94Wyzj5GoV/M31OxGD5Nb9Rf2xDDM?= =?us-ascii?Q?rTzFaE3ItR5QS+TNmOxng887rtc2KZVWResmBEou2DRdwk3HszG0532mw/Fh?= =?us-ascii?Q?lMAL0hpmBuyRfNWNheS/eKzt77GYh4ta2dsCzRFr7dhINKQ1R057xlte+2zC?= =?us-ascii?Q?al8vozH0xjBI982LYteRP2pKpIksiheGPtwCMOyTEpDtSE1lXR9UU2j6NaVS?= =?us-ascii?Q?uxM5xfWHb+reu2v3/a2JDu2zAKxMkbWM66xUCcO9pH5rCgfULiizYM6QZaK+?= =?us-ascii?Q?gju9YsuNXK4R67jpWfDFhPslffVEhj7wYSkJpelOFnYk5FzeMtvNPKDxdsUk?= =?us-ascii?Q?ececTAQrsRNSOaN7IsMabf2nqqVCgQ9Z1GWZGn/hA0gdOrvxN1FW8RO+uXM/?= =?us-ascii?Q?OGSKIVxHdBOJ7nrrVadrdz369Umnc7w9EipznvRTige3vPVS9RlXuwThP3g3?= =?us-ascii?Q?YzfXRON63w6JyNVk7o2IPxPm7cxuIV2WcOEpsGoydKB5n3s2JyNoUCRjfNzV?= =?us-ascii?Q?qbJu+tg7opsj9uLf9KQ4LEo2PzcGZTfnfubpZjB07QReRBrF6P37znID0AQi?= =?us-ascii?Q?1nEdCM9dQpgkYuOWC665JUpDfAUTPUS0Iw/JkVVAsjXxecrmVHHPH4NRYZxS?= =?us-ascii?Q?79AwCb1ogXKBuDLi4XVpXbpDFp1iVivXTVe5eh02mavF0ZIeT+aSyY/Kvr8d?= =?us-ascii?Q?2QNRB356mHQrRtOumQrsF8shPIhHAMTXwCK2F8gjEo26DpEPzLvaF6ALwlhK?= =?us-ascii?Q?QPqcTaOgWQ+o66iNQEZ2xPvz+aZsuCV/uytshPNwOxbx4l0DmrmaOXvFyFIg?= =?us-ascii?Q?3Pv312DSQOhEkZxCI6r2a54b94vZlhHU9gHlKyLlmz3Ko1cMiZpUrSM00yHs?= =?us-ascii?Q?pIZbEqWaIAxr6LY/4Wdn74Yc=3D?= X-Microsoft-Antispam-Message-Info: F6n7YfsqlGNtknMpcEwF3EB15Za1GMrHGu4vrC66jthrc3Qw60ehfGT6VQtG7yeXLKFDOEsme1reEGNk8CkNTHYcvXEnpIASNzx5zR1X9Kz3HVJNf/Iv6SERPwt4+GegUsQIQM42nXJF2pqjR1IpqgofiWgbUDutUuKkC+rMMR274MMvFG8xNlwiLq1sZBK7 X-Microsoft-Exchange-Diagnostics: 1; AM5PR0501MB2033; 6:CG6kz41+5HGWfFXxyvmjVFnOPy3y4olGE8Hy96Dv3DFgTl1QROwI+an6uemV/999q0PMKO/q4sfxTevy9NqN9u8R7y1Qy/b8jHP5kXOtp+YGKsHtAkiszK7QSgCUkdqovqGyaUyO2M4KPghrYmE7rrj1rEraS2bdJg13eKKr9f2bAKfwuXvdgb7+uzW0gXP9SH+rSpLz/2YCc6sr9fwXA+UyvoEBGGJdPpzP742xdMBpyq3o+hw9CZ+lp6Lqj0TKtYFDXyVgozH/eNNbP6yhLYOd3BciAXoWnej65kbknaqbj1UtE5cO/cArxrCNXiZKH/YwR8+OegoehSa3ZnCOg6XJwjS8p6qOdONk/IHFki+BXgESQHUa4FU+71ltBN0xnXNbyYehQxYg/PMcFCe/wkUjBID+9tjf+Cogb8wh4ZPl9L94iUfiemn3KoMadmDSxmWu4F6OZu74pFYbU09ymA==; 5:HAt8U2dr38XjSpP+cl6l8jgPpiclHL//0LNb2n2DLHHQ8ocY+8Yjm0u9K2ZEMZ48cD2BHN6f9bb/t5PJdOepv6RbmcwzD+ivD1LKCBOC/POfcLgpqPWYDLQ6vNW0AKO70aV8/9599ikL/j7bqEvKfVz4WaFcevrtccZuvmQIo6s=; 24:rktzNrB+ttkJspdhInayO062JEyMT4HR9maRs9IABSEhsdVMXk71sIof1HvfsBWt9tbzP5ekqMoagpLt+ADjFc0Rg74nl6zN94zBpLrQWhg= S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-Microsoft-Exchange-Diagnostics: 1; AM5PR0501MB2033; 7:bqL8PovjF+FCQldVHpZtpQ2AWuvC0+vlvxKHtj0GZ5a6Sw+U6clBpwjDL0fQXJqcyLK/aYAaYFdEjPejVvi0Sr0bFrAaRfT7jCRlTc+TyGX61Us59ULRSxRAWIbaLgUmLbYgVl/ZDSj5E/JNQ9g4rAW6aUoVlRgnkxsl0mzjT01wiBirivSXVPcs7kt716bWumgpcTm6/5HZsUbxOlpCp5p2nAizWzi1J5EF0i0wzodPEq0uCEsTbwSQROI+wmYU X-MS-Office365-Filtering-Correlation-Id: 34d480fb-0eac-4ad3-e263-08d5a9c44172 X-OriginatorOrg: Mellanox.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 24 Apr 2018 09:17:50.8431 (UTC) X-MS-Exchange-CrossTenant-Network-Message-Id: 34d480fb-0eac-4ad3-e263-08d5a9c44172 X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: a652971c-7d2e-4d9b-a6a4-d149256f461b X-MS-Exchange-Transport-CrossTenantHeadersStamped: AM5PR0501MB2033 Subject: Re: [dpdk-dev] [PATCH 1/3] net/mlx5: separate TSO function in Tx data path X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 24 Apr 2018 09:17:54 -0000 On Sun, Apr 08, 2018 at 08:41:19PM +0800, Xueming Li wrote: > Separate TSO function to make logic of mlx5_tx_burst clear. > > Signed-off-by: Xueming Li > --- Acked-by: Yongseok Koh Thanks